This is a new song titled "Visiting Beautiful Kyoto."
It is of Japanese style. The instrumental version and the vocal version are in one song.

https://soundcloud.com/hirokata1121/visiting-beautiful-kyoto

It is a kind of the sister work of my previous post "Invitation to Impressive Scenery".

I originally made this song more than a year ago. This time, I fully reviewed it, added the vocal part with Japanese lyrics written by me, and made it reborn as a new song.

I hope you like it.

Its video version is on Youtube. The pictures of beautiful scenes in Kyoto are on it.

https://youtu.be/XigvST7nlX0

Japanese lyrics and its English translation are also available there (on video and in comment).

*** Song Summary ***
First part (Instrumental):
Key=C, Tempo 80
Style: PNOMOOD2.STY (PianoMood2 -Gentle Soundtrack st)
Second part (Japanese vocal):
Key=A, Tempo 80
Style: ARPORK34.STY (Orchestral arpeggio 3/4)
Vocal: Mew (Vocaloid)

Sonar X3 was used for assignment of VSTi instruments to MIDI tracks and final tuning of the song.

Thank you for your comment. I am glad you like the voice of Mew. I myself like her voice as well because it is so natural and beautiful. I think the vocaloid voice fits quite well to the song like this; its tempo is slow and melody line is simple (i.e. fewer notes) and then each note is long enough to emphasize phonetic characteristics of Japanese.
